Front Office Manager Job Vacancy


A premium hotel located in Nairobi is urgently seeking a dynamic, qualified individual to fill the position of Front Office Manager.

The position reports to the General Manager.

Duties
  • Supervision of the front office staff, from maintaining proper cash control to guest service standards on a day-to-day basis
  • Attending to Guests’ enquiries, requests, complaints and compliments
  • Monitoring departmental costs to ensure performance against budget
  • Ensuring proper training and procedures are in place to ensure provision of quality services
  • Attending to crisis or emergency situations and performing service recovery
  • Recording the details of events in Duty Manager Log Book and to take necessary actions
  • Supervising Reception personnel to ensure optimum occupancy and average room rate for purpose of maximizing revenue.
  • Monitoring Front Office personnel to ensure guests receive warm and personalized service.
  • Informing other operating departments, notably Housekeeping of all Front Office matters that concern them.
  • Preparation of daily and management reports
Requirements:
  • At least 3 years working experience in a similar position
  • Degree in hospitality and/or social sciences
  • The ability to display a high degree of professionalism and integrity as befitting a member of management.
  • Demonstrated supervisor skills; good judgment and common sense.
  • Computer literate with knowledge of a variety of computer software applications, including the Microsoft Office Suite.
  • Superior written and oral communication skills.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ills, with the ability to set priorities for self and others.
